A Wohngemeinschaft (WG) — a shared flat — is the most realistic first housing option in Munich for newcomers. Getting a full 1-room apartment is almost impossible from abroad; a WG is approachable if you know the rituals.

Realistic prices

  • Average WG-Zimmer (room): €800/month warm (incl. Nebenkosten). Munich leads Germany here.
  • Schwabing / Maxvorstadt: €900–€1,100 for nicer rooms.
  • Sendling / Laim / Moosach: €650–€800.
  • 1-Zimmer-Wohnung: €1,100–€1,600 cold + Nebenkosten.

How Besichtigungen work

  1. Browse + message. WG-Gesucht listings get 20–50 applications within hours. Personalise every message (2–3 sentences about you
    • why this WG in particular).
  2. Besichtigung (viewing): group format with 10–30 candidates per slot, 20–30 min each. Dress business-casual; bring a Mieterbewerbungsmappe (see below).
  3. The "match": existing flatmates pick who they want. It's genuinely a personality interview — personality matters more than Schufa score in a WG.
  4. Mietvertrag: for a Hauptmieter (main tenant) role, the landlord signs with you; for an Untermieter (subletter) the existing tenant does.

Mieterbewerbungsmappe

A short PDF you print or attach to every application. Include:

  • Short self-intro (2–3 sentences: your name, job/study, why Munich, hobbies).
  • Copy of passport + visa.
  • Anmeldebescheinigung if you already have it (once registered).
  • Schufa-BonitätsAuskunft (€29.95 at meineschufa.de) OR, if you're new to Germany: a bank balance screenshot + the statement "Neuanmeldung in Deutschland — Schufa folgt".
  • Payslips (last 3) OR admission letter OR scholarship proof OR Verpflichtungserklärung from a sponsor.
  • Professional reference if available.

Red flags + scam patterns

  • "Transfer the deposit and I'll send keys via DHL" — always a scam. Never send money before seeing the flat and signing in person.
  • "I'm in the UK / USA right now, so we'll handle everything online" — scam.
  • Far-below-market rent — a Schwabing 1-Zimmer-Wohnung for €600 doesn't exist.
  • Fake Schufa links — only meineschufa.de (and licensed intermediaries like bonify) sell real Schufa reports.
  • Pressure tactics — "only 1 hour to decide or we'll move to the next candidate". Legitimate landlords give you a day.

Tips from people who found WGs in their first month

  • Be on WG-Gesucht by 08:00. Listings posted overnight get too many messages by 10:00.
  • Don't apply from a stock template. Genuine, specific messages (even 3 sentences) get 5x more responses.
  • Offer a video call if you're applying from abroad. Existing flatmates appreciate seeing a face.
  • Check the Anmeldung note — some WGs explicitly refuse Anmeldung-eligible rooms ("keine Anmeldung möglich"). Skip those if you need your address registered.
